Default Picture in a UserForm

Hi All,

I'm having trouble getting a picture into a picture control in a userform.
Every time I select a picture file for the control I get a error message,
something like 'Picture file is not valid'

Default Picture in a UserForm

The user form image control does not accept all picture formats. It accepts
(I think) gif, jpg, and bmp, but not png.

You could insert the picture into a worksheet, copy the picture, switch to
the VB Editor, click in the entry field for the picture, and use Ctrl+V to
paste the image.
